#148918 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#148918 is composed of 7.8% red, 53.7%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 82.5% yellow and 46.3% black. It has a hue angle of 122.1 degrees, a saturation of 74.5% and a lightness of 30.8%. #148918 color hex could be obtained by blending #28ff30 with #001300. Closest websafe color is: #009900.

● #148918 color description : Dark lime green.
#148918 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#148918 has RGB values of R:20, G:137, B:24 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0, Y:0.82, K:0.46. Its decimal value is 1345816.

Shades and Tints of #148918
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#eefdee is the lightest one.

Tones of #148918
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4a534b is the less saturated color, while #029b07 is the most saturated one.
